skeetnz 0 Posted July 5, 2012 The ingame speech function should be volume dependant. So the louder you shout, the further your voice travels. There could be a reverb applied if its shouted over a distance, for realism. Would make meeting new survivors easier and determining friend from foe. If you saw a survivor in the distance, you could shout to them to find out their demeanor. Also if you shout loud and there are zombies in the vicinity, they will be alerted too.
